What if "nothing" was the most powerful concept of all?

In Theory of Nothing, author Rohit Patel offers a humorous yet deeply reflective journey into the philosophy of emptiness, contentment, and the curious paradox that we are born with nothing and leave with even less. Blending ancient wisdom from the Bhagavad Gita, meditative insights like Shooniyam (the pause between thoughts), and laugh-out-loud anecdotes, this book transforms "nothing" into everything you didn't know you needed.

This isn't your average self-help guide-it's a witty, thought-provoking invitation to live fully, love freely, and stop chasing what doesn't matter. Perfect for readers who enjoy spiritual musings with a side of humor and a dash of irreverence, Theory of Nothing will help you find peace in the pause and meaning in the madness.

Learn why nothing is the ultimate goal-and the final truth.
